What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has emerged as an effective resource for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. It offers an extended history of substance use by capturing biomarkers within the strands' fibers as the hair grows. When gathered near the scalp, hair allows for up to a 3-month detection period for alcohol and other substances. Hair collection is straightforward, not easily tampered with, and simple to transport.

A 1.5-inch segment of around 200 hairs (roughly the size of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p provides 100mg, which is the optimal amount for testing and verifying. For tests involving EtG, add-ons, or more than 10 panels, a 150mg sample is advised. It's suggested to weigh the sample using a jeweler’s scale. If scalp hair isn't an option, a comparable amount of body hair can be used. Head hair specifically indicates scalp hair, whereas body hair covers all other types (like facial or axillary hair).

Process Overview

The essential stages in the lab processing of a drug analysis result include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ning is the preliminary step of processing a sample into the lab's framework. This step confirms that the sample was correctly sealed and sent, allocates a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and finalizes any extra data entry not available via an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ening provides a quick initial check for drugs. Though Screening is cost-efficient for excluding drug use in most samples, a positive result in Screening requires confirmation for legal acceptance. Samples showing tentative positive results in Screening need further validation.

Should a sample show a presumed positive during the Screening stage, additional hair is extracted from the initial sample for preparation in the Extraction phase. Here, drugs are removed from hair at much lower levels than in other methods (such as urine or oral fluid), making hair drug analysis the most challenging methodology.

Confirmation for any positive result from Screening is executed via G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Any samples that show presumptive positivity are cleansed before verification as required. The entire lab procedure from Accessioning to Confirmation undergoes review under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air classification and under ISO / IEC 17025 standards accreditation.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ection window: Hair drug analysis can identify substance use for up to 90 days, unlike urine tests which offer a shorter detection span.
  • Challenging to falsify: Cheating a hair drug test is notably difficult, which enhances the accuracy of results.
  • Delivers historical insight: It offers a timeline of drug use over time, beyond just recent use.

Limitations:

  • Recent usage undetectable: Drugs take roughly 5-7 days to become evident in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ug analyses are generally pricier than other testing methods.
  • Result variability: Aspects such as hair color and growth rate variations can influence drug metabolite concentration in hair.

Note: Despite often being termed "hair follicle tests," the analysis examines the hair strand itself,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
